Man Accused Of Firing Crossbow At Neighbor

Incident Started With Dispute Over Dog, Police Say

A man used a crossbow pistol to end an argument over a dog, Lincoln police said.

Police said Carlos Lupercio, 49, got into an argument with his 25-year-old neighbor about the breed of the neighbor's dog. The owner said the dog was a pit bull, but the older man said it was a Labrador, Omaha station KETV reported.

After the argument, police said Lupercio, who is wheelchair bound, went into his apartment and returned with a black crossbow. Officers said Lupercio shot the crossbow when his neighbor tried to extend his hand to apologize.

When police arrived, Lupercio still had the crossbow in his possession.

Later, he was arrested on charges of making terroristic threats, use of a weapon to commit a felony, discharge of a weapon within city limits, resisting arrest and failure to comply.
